State your name, middlename, nickname and birth date

René Kroon, Pingel (born on 31th of August 1978)

Personal Biography

I started playing on an electric organ when I was about 7 or 8 years old. I got a really bad teacher who took away all my joy in making music, so I quit after 1 or 2 years (don’t know the exact time anymore). I re-started playing organ in 1990, got a keyboard about  2 years later and joined a “semi band” (Sympho Doom/Death Metal) in 1993 and quitted that in 1994. In 1994 I joined my first real (Death Metal) band named “Save Thy Souls” and did my first gig that same year. Everybody thought that we were a Christian band because of our name, which we were NOT, so we changed the name into “Stigmatheist”. We released a mini cd called “Standing For Her Grave” in 1996 and got comments about our superb control of the English language! It actually should have been “Standing At Her Grave”, but hey…. we were young! In 1996 I joined the band (Sympho/Prog Rock) “The Barstool Philosophers” and in 1997 I joined the Conservatory to study keyboards and music production. In 1998 we (Stigmatheist) released a full length cd called “It All Ends Today” via a record label. In 1999 I didn’t had any fun anymore in playing in “Stigmatheist”, so I quit this band. Also “The Barstool Philosophers” quit that year because we could never get a singer in the band (even André Vuurboom (ex-Sun Caged) did an audition, but he didn’t like our music at that time) and our Bass player didn’t have any time left for rehearsing anymore. Somewhere this year I joined a cover band, but that sucked really hard, so this band quits somewhere in 2000. Also In 1999 I join the band “Lack Of Hope”. We made something between Doom Metal and Electro / Dark wave / Gothic music with some classical/Spanish influences in it. We worked really hard to get somewhere, but due to personal and musical issues the band falls apart around 2002. Because of health and other personal issues, I quit the Conservatory in 2000 and start working in a music store. In 2001 The band “The Barstool Philosophers” comes together again (without singer). Then we found a singer and later changed from bass player. We still exist and are about to release a cd soon. In 2004 I joined “Sun Caged”. This band gives me the opportunity to improve my musical skills and do more live playing then ever before!!! Let’s hope these 2 bands may stay together for a loooooooong time……………….
